A noble metal-free proton-exchange membrane fuel cell based on bio-inspired molecular catalysts

Hydrogen is a promising energy vector for storing renewable energies: obtained from water-splitting, in electrolysers or photoelectrochemical cells, it can be turned back to electricity on demand in fuel cells (FCs).
